Taking Back Sunday post video for ‘Better Homes and Gardens’

Taking Back Sunday have posted the official video for ‘Better Homes and Gardens’. The track is taken from last year’s ‘Happiness Is’ LP, available now. The melodic veterans will be playing a couple of warm-up shows before heading to Slam Dunk Festival this weekend.

Superheaven release video for ‘Gushin’ Blood’

Superheaven have premiered a suitably bloody video for ‘Gushin’ Blood’ over at NPR. The track is taken from the bands excellent new album ‘Ours Is Chrome’, which is available now via SideOneDummy Records. You can check the video for the track out below.
